4. Eat Local Breakfast

Start your day on a delicious note by indulging in a local breakfast in Langza. Savor the flavors of Spitian cuisine, which often includes freshly baked bread, butter tea, Tibetan dumplings (momos), and nutritious barley-based porridge (tsampa).

The use of local ingredients and traditional cooking techniques ensures a wholesome and satisfying meal. Enjoy the warmth of the local hospitality as you relish the flavors and aromas of the region’s culinary delights.

10. Taste the local Alcohol

Indulge in the flavors of Spitian alcohol, crafted using traditional techniques and local ingredients. Sample the renowned Chang, a fermented barley-based drink that is a staple in the region.

Experience the unique taste profiles and the warmth that spreads through your body with each sip.

Engage in conversations with the locals over a glass of local alcohol, sharing stories and laughter as you appreciate the craftsmanship behind these traditional beverages. It’s a delightful way to toast to the rich culture and warm hospitality of Langza.

How to Get to Langza

1. By Road

The most common way to reach Langza is by road. The Spiti Valley is well connected by road networks, and travelers can take a scenic drive from major nearby cities like Shimla or Manali.

The journey offers breathtaking views of the Himalayan mountains, winding roads, and picturesque landscapes. It’s recommended to hire a taxi or use public transportation to navigate the rugged terrain and reach Langza comfortably.

2. By Train

Although there is no direct train connectivity to Langza, travelers can opt for a train journey to reach the nearest railway station, which is Shimla or Joginder Nagar. From there, they can continue the onward journey to Langza by road.

Trains provide a convenient and comfortable mode of transportation, allowing travelers to enjoy the scenic beauty of the region before reaching their destination.

3. By Air

The nearest airport to Langza is the Kullu-Manali Airport, also known as Bhuntar Airport, located in Kullu. After landing at the airport, travelers can hire a taxi or take a bus to reach Langza, enjoying the picturesque landscapes during the road journey.

Flights to Kullu-Manali Airport are available from major cities in India, making it a convenient option for those seeking to reach Langza quickly.

Best Time to Visit Langza

The best time to visit Langza, nestled in the mesmerizing Spiti Valley, is during the summer and autumn months, from May to October. During this period, the weather in Langza remains pleasant and favorable for exploration and outdoor activities.

The temperatures are moderate, ranging from cool to mild, allowing visitors to comfortably explore the village and its surroundings. The summer months offer clear skies, making it an ideal time for stargazing and enjoying the breathtaking vistas.

Autumn brings vibrant hues to the landscapes, creating a picturesque setting. It’s recommended to avoid the winter months, as Langza experiences heavy snowfall and extreme cold, which can hinder travel and accessibility.

Things to Know Before Visiting Langza

1. Altitude: Langza is located at a high altitude of around 4,400 meters, so be prepared for the effects of altitude sickness and acclimatize properly.

2. Limited Facilities: Langza is a remote village with limited facilities, so stock up on essentials and be prepared for basic amenities.

3. Weather Conditions: The weather in Langza can be unpredictable, with cold temperatures and harsh winters, so pack appropriate clothing and gear.

4. Mobile Network and Internet: Expect limited or no mobile network coverage and internet connectivity in Langza, so plan accordingly.

5. Respect Local Customs: Langza is a culturally rich village, so respect the local customs, traditions, and Buddhist monasteries while visiting.
